Leica M-D (262)


bythom leica m-d.jpg

Basically an M (Type 262) without the rear LCD and controls (an ISO dial replaces that).

  • Sensor: 24mp CMOSIS CMOS sensor, 23.9x35.8 (no crop from 35mm film), Bayer color filtration, no AA filter
  • Mount: Leica M
  • Images: 5952 x 3992 JPEG and 14-bit raw DNG, 3 fps max (24 image buffer), 2 fps in more silent wind mode
  • Video:  not included, nor is Live View
  • Shutter: mechanical 60 sec to 1/4,000 sec, bulb, 1/180 X-sync 
  • Exposure: center-weighted, -3 to +3EV exposure compensation, 7 white balance settings (plus Custom), ISO 200-6400
  • Focus: manual focus, 10x zoom and peaking (Live View only)
  • Display: no LCD; optical viewfinder (.68x magnification) framelines for 28, 35, 50, 75, 90mm, 135mm lenses, optional EVF, -3 to +3 diopter
  • Flash: hot shoe, 1/180 flash sync, red-eye reduction, slow sync, rear sync
  • Remote: no
  • Other Notable Features: auto lens compensation
  • Cards: SD, SDHC, SDXC
  • Battery: BP-SCL2
  • Size: 5.5 x 3.1 x 1.7" (139 x 80 x 42mm) wide, tall, deep
  • Weight: 24 ounces (680g)
  • Colors: Black
  • Price: US$5195 body only
  • Announced: November 20, 2015
  • Current software: v1.0.0.4 (June 2016)
